What this means

This registration is in, or will soon enter, a USPTO maintenance window. Missing a Section 8 or Section 9 filing can cancel the registration.

Status 800: Status 800 means the registration was renewed after acceptable combined Section 8 and Section 9 filings. The mark remains registered for another 10-year term with active federal protection.
